Canterbury Park – news and races for August 9, 2025

Canterbury Park in Shakopee, Minnesota presents a competitive card of thoroughbred racing on Saturday, August 9, 2025, featuring maiden special weight, starter optional claiming, and allowance competitions. The day’s racing offers solid betting opportunities across multiple divisions with field sizes ranging from six to seven runners per race.

Weather and Track Conditions

Saturday’s weather forecast calls for mostly sunny skies with temperatures reaching 91°F in the Shakopee area. Current track conditions show the main racing surface as fast with the turf course listed as firm. Track officials have set the temporary rail distance at 30 feet for today’s races.

Race 1 – Maiden Special Weight

The opening race features six runners competing over one mile on the turf course for a purse of $28,000. Airmail Flyer enters as the 9/5 morning line favorite after finishing second over the same course and distance last month. The gelding showed improvement in that effort and appears ready to break his maiden today.

Moe Dingers, listed at 3/1 odds, presents the primary challenge to the favorite. Trainer connections indicate the colt has been working well in morning training sessions leading up to this assignment. It’s Miles at 7/2 offers additional value in what appears to be an evenly matched field.

Westdakota rounds out the main contenders at 9/2 morning line odds, while Shankapotamus and Cocalina complete the field at longer prices. Handicappers suggest the race should come down to the top three choices on the morning line.

Race 2 – Starter Optional Claiming

The second race brings together seven runners in a starter optional claiming event over one mile and 70 yards on the dirt track. Supreme Dominance earned favoritism at 5/2 odds after capturing a similar contest at Canterbury Park last month. The gelding has shown consistency in recent starts and appears well-positioned for another strong performance.

Pacific Theater, the 7/2 second choice, represents the primary threat to the favorite. Recent form suggests this runner has been training forwardly and could provide the main competition. Mr Fabricator has shown resurgent form in recent outings and merits consideration at 4/1 odds.

Kid’s Inheritance, Hidden Profit, Requisition, and My Calante complete the field with morning line odds ranging from 9/2 to 10/1. Track handicappers note the race appears competitive among the top four choices.

Stakes Action

Today’s card includes the Minnesota Derby, a $75,000 added stakes event for three-year-old colts and geldings competing over 8.32 furlongs on the dirt track. Additionally, the Glitter Star Allowance features three-year-old and up fillies and mares over 8.5 furlongs for a $30,000 purse.
